Discover: Lands Unknown: A different adventure lurks inside every single copy of Corey Konieczka’s ambitious survival and exploration game. The designer tells us about the creation of one of the first-ever unique games, and reveals what to expect as we venture out on our personal journey.

Tabletop Gaming Live 2018: We round up the fantastic games, people, talks and more from our first London convention, and announce the first details of next year’s return to Alexandra Palace for fun and games.

Transformers Trading Card Game: Autobots and Decepticons go head-to-head in the competitive card-battler from the makers of Magic: The Gathering. We transform and roll out with tips for getting into the game.

Toys in Games: Dig out those forgotten Lego bricks, Jenga sets and Hot Wheels cars and use them to experience some of the most inventive and entertaining games on the tabletop – that you already own! Plus, try out an exclusive RPG powered by Pop-Up Pirate!

Fowers Games: Designer Tim Fowers and artist Ryan Goldsberry – the talented duo behind Burgle Bros., Paperback and more – chat about their indie attitude to making games and why don’t plan to play by the rules anytime soon.

Sensible Object: After making plastic animals high-tech in Beasts of Balance, the London team is inviting artificial intelligence to the table with its latest game. The studio’s Alex Fleetwood predicts what the future of gaming looks like.

PlayFusion: The creators of Lightseekers and Warhammer: Age of Sigmar – Champions reveal how they’re revolutionising trading card games by encouraging phones at the table.

Relationships in Games: The designers behind romantic roleplaying board game Fog of Love and kinky card game Consentacle discuss how games can bring us closer together in real life.

How We Made Santorini: Dr. Gordon Hamilton takes us inside the 30-year odyssey to creating his abstract tower-building masterpiece.

Fantastic magazine

There are so few good tabletop gaming magazines being published today, which is strange, considering the resurgence in traditional gaming. Aside from the 3 popular miniature war gaming magazines, there's a serious lack of magazine style content for serious board gamers. So it was with much anticipation that I looked forward to the publication of Tabletop Gaming last year, which promised broad coverage of ALL types of tabletop games (board, card, minis games). It has not disappointed. Besides lavish visuals, the magazine offers dozens of quick-hitting game reviews, combined with some in-depth interviews of companies and game designers, and features on hot games. It's a fun read and highly recommended. I've just re-upped my subscription for another year. Keep up the good work guys! Revisto 06 junho 2016
